Understanding Car KeysTypes of Car Keys
Before diving into how to replace Lost Car Key a lost car key, it is important to comprehend the various types of car keys. Each type might require a various approach for replacement:
Key TypeDescriptionConventional KeysStandard metal keys with no electronic elements. Common in older cars.Transponder KeysKeys with a chip that interacts with the car's ignition system for added security.Smart KeysHigh-tech keys that allow for keyless entry and ignition. Generally utilized in modern-day automobiles.Key FobsPush-button controls that can lock/unlock the car doors and might start the engine without a traditional key.Actions to Replace a Lost Car Key
When you lose a car key, there are a number of steps you can take to get a replacement. The procedure can differ based upon the kind of key and the vehicle producer. Here's an extensive guide:
1. Recognize Your Key Type
Determining the kind of key you require to replace is important. Check your vehicle's owner manual or look up your car design online to understand if it utilizes a conventional key, transponder key, smart key, or key fob.
2. Gather Necessary Information
Before going out to replace your key, gather crucial information including:
Vehicle Identification Number (VIN): Usually discovered on the control panel or in the owner's handbook.Evidence of Ownership: Such as registration files or the title of the car.Key Information: If offered, the initial key or a picture of it can help the locksmith or dealer.3. Select Your Replacement Option
There are three main options for replacing a lost car key:

Option 1: Dealership Replacement
Pros:Guaranteed compatibility with your vehicle.Access to the vehicle's particular key codes.Cons:Often the most pricey choice.
Option 2: Locksmith Services
Pros:Usually more affordable than dealerships.Can come to your location for benefit.Cons:Not all locksmiths have the equipment to program transponder or clever keys.
Alternative 3: DIY Key Replacement Kits
Pros:May save cash and be faster.Available for certain kinds of keys, typically standard ones.Cons:Not suitable for transponder or smart keys.Needs some tech-savviness to program.4. Replace the KeyDealer: If you pick this path, present your VIN and evidence of ownership. They will generally cut and program a brand-new key for you.Locksmith professional: Contact a mobile locksmith professional who can make keys on-site. They might need to program the brand-new key, particularly for transponder keys.Do it yourself Kits: Follow the consisted of instructions carefully. Some kits might require extra tools to create and program the key.5. Test the New Key
As soon as you've acquired your new key, ensure to evaluate it in all functions. If it has a remote function, guarantee it works effortlessly with your vehicle.
Expense Considerations
The expense of changing a lost car key can differ extensively depending upon several aspects. The following table offers a summary of possible costs related to different types of keys:
Key TypeApproximated Cost RangeNotesTraditional Key₤ 2 - ₤ 5Simple key cutting at hardware stores.Transponder Key₤ 75 - ₤ 250Includes key cutting and shows.Smart Key₤ 200 - ₤ 500Advanced shows might be necessary.Key Fob₤ 100 - ₤ 300Replacement fobs may require special programs.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)How can I prevent losing my car keys in the future?
A good practice is to always designate a specific place for your keys. Keychains with Bluetooth gadgets can also assist locate your keys utilizing a smartphone app.
Is it legal to replace car keys?
Yes, it's legal to get a replacement key if you can show ownership of the vehicle.
Can I replace my car key without the initial?
Yes, as long as you have proof of ownership and the VIN, dealerships and qualified locksmith professionals can often make a brand-new key without the initial.
What occurs if I lose my key fob?
If you lose your key fob, the replacement procedure is comparable to that of car keys. Contact a dealership or locksmith for assistance, bearing in mind the expenses could be higher due to the fob's innovation.
